What is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ging?
Premium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ging for Shelf Display is a flexible coffee pouch with a packaging panel that is rectangular in shape. Traditionally, standup pouches have a rounded and/or oval bottom. In contrast, a bottom that is flat creates a box-like shape when the pouch is filled and stands.
Some of the important features include:
•A top closure and side seals which seal the pouch on the bottom and sides.
•Side gussets that allow expansion of the bag.
•A bottom panel which is either separate from the bag or folded.
This flexibility of these Bottoms allows for a size range from a 200g retail size all the way to a 2kg bulk size. The Bottoms were created in response to the need to merge the flexibility of a pouch and the rigidity of a box.
Why the Flat Bottom Design Works for Shelf Display
The Premium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ging for Shelf Display has the advantage of standing on its own when placed on a store shelf. This design feature naturally influences how the customer interacts with the coffee products.
•Upright packaging: The packaging’s wide base eliminates the packaging’s tendency to tip, even on very short shelves and especially when coffee stock is low.
•Designed for interaction: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ging, with no protrusions, presents your brand packaging directly to the customer.
•Aligned and organized: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ging bags align next to one another for an organized and professional retail display.
The flat bottom design of the bags, combined with their unique structure, helps maintain their shape, even as the bag becomes partially empty. This helps maintain the quality appearance and assurance of the coffee packaging.
How the Design Allows for Increased Customization
The other valued characteristic of Premium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ging for Shelf Display is the packaging’s surface which is highly customizable. With the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ging, the flat front, back and side surfaces can be printed without the risk of stretching the surfaces or distorting the graphics.
•Maximum visibility: The bag can be printed, literally, from side-to-side with a graphic or design which helps maximize the visibility of the packaging.
•Controlled quality: The flat surfaces of the bags, combined with the printing techniques of rotogravure, flexography or direct printing, allow for high quality and consistent results of packaging throughout a production run.
•Variety of finishes: With the ability to control the quality of the packaging, brands can choose to finish their packaging with a variety of options, such as gloss or matte finishes.

4. Add-Ons That Improve Packaging Functionality and Add Freshness
Coffee consumers expect that the flavor will be preserved from the first sip to the last. Many of the functional features one might expect are easily integrated into the flat bottom packaging style.
•A one-way degassing valve will allow CO2 to escape while blocking oxygen, thereby extending selection to customers beyond peak freshness.
•A resealable zipper will also allow reopening and closing the packaging to preserve freshness.
•Laser scoring, or a tear notch, will add a clean opening without the need for an opening tool.
These features are integrated during manufacturing and do not interfere with the bag’s shelf stability.

Material and Barrier Options
Choosing the right material for Premium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ging for Shelf Display depends on the coffee’s expected shelf life and distribution route.
| Material Type | Barrier Performance | Sustainability Profile |
| Foil laminate | High (excellent oxygen/light block) | Conventional (not widely recyclable) |
| Clear EVOH film | High to medium | Conventional or recyclable depending on structure |
| Recyclable LDPE | Medium | Single-material recyclable |
| Kraft + liner | Medium (liner provides barrier) | Paper exterior, liner varies |
| PLA (plant-based) | Medium | Industrially compostable |

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is Premium Flat Bottom Coffee Packaging for Shelf Display recyclable?
A: Yes, but it depends on the materials. For a fully recyclable option, select mono-material LDPE or PE. Brands that have access to industrial composting can choose the compostable PLA.
Q: Will flat bottom style accommodate a degassing valve?
A: Definitely, it will actually assist in maintaining the bag’s stability. One can install a degassing valve on either the front or back panel, it will not interfere with the seal.
Q: How versatile is the packaging when it comes to printing?
A: This type of packaging accommodates Rotogravure, flexographic, or digital printing. Additionally, printing can occur marginless.
Q: How suitable is the packaging for e-commerce purposes?
A: The design of the packaging is fully e-commerce oriented. It can be transported flat, optimizing shipping space. The packaging also features a puncture resistant seal to maintain packaging integrity.
